Full Time Job
The Sales Planner position serves as the main support system for the TV sales teams and Revenue Management and Client Services. Planners support advertiser strategies, coordinate weekly business activity, troubleshoot commercial inventory issues, manage liability, build TV campaigns and research marketplace intelligence. Sales Planners must be able to become experts on the pre-sale sales process to communicate effectively with various teams across ESPN's sales organization, as well as build and maintain external relationships resulting in superior customer service of each assigned account.
Responsibilities
• Partner and support with sales managers, account executives and Revenue Management and Client Service management on the pre-sale stage of advertising sales campaigns
• Develop, create and maintain sales proposals driving revenue through strategically packaging all ESPN Networks
• Steward major buys by analyzing campaign delivery and managing preparation of make-goods
• Serve as a liaison to programming, coordinating schedule and program changes and updating planning management
• Drive communication between multiple internal departments relative to advertiser deal points, ensuring an efficient and timely implementation process and delivery
• Communicate effectively in order to properly deliver proposals, revisions, answer questions, and fulfill any and all day to day requests all the while maintaining world class customer service internally and externally
• Assist the marketing teams in proposing creative elements in campaign proposals
• Ensure accuracy of all internal reporting for your assigned accounts by regularly updating ordered/held/working status, liability, flight and programming changes
• Provide marketplace intelligence by proactively reading the trades, building external and internal relationships
• Exhibit professional excellence at all times and approach work with passion and positivity
Basic Qualifications
• Minimum 1 year prior agency, network or media experience
• Experience with account management and client service within a TV or Digital environment
• Advanced Computer skills required, with a focus on Excel
• Working knowledge of Media Math
Required Education
• Bachelor's Degree
